South Philly Shooting and Rhawnhurst Attack Leave Two Dead, Two Injured

Two separate double shootings in Philadelphia have left two people dead and others injured, prompting an active investigation by city police. The incidents occurred days apart in different neighborhoods: one in South Philadelphia and another in Rhawnhurst and together reveal another violent weekend in the city.

The first shooting happened October 9, Thursday evening at the intersection of Broad Street and Packer Avenue in South Philadelphia. Police said that at approximately 6:12 p.m., officers responded to reports of a person with a gun. When they arrived, they found two men who had been shot and a vehicle at the scene that had been struck by gunfire at least fifteen times.

According to investigators, a 22-year-old man had been shot in the chest. He was transported by the Philadelphia Fire Department Medic Unit to Jefferson University Hospital, where he was pronounced dead at 6:48 p.m. A second victim, a 23-year-old man, was found with a gunshot wound to the stomach. Police took him to Penn Presbyterian Medical Center, where he was listed in critical condition…
